Micro-FluorCam FC 2000
Description of the Micro-FluorCam FC 2000
A: Measuring Flashes; B: Ultra-High Sensitive CCD Camera; C: Supplementary Output;
D: Olympus Frame; E: Variable Excitation Filter Sets; F: Changeable Optical Filter Modules.
Micro-FluorCam FC 2000 extends the complete capacity of kinetic chlorophyll or GFP fluorescence imaging to the realm of individual cells and sub-cellular structures. All conventional fluorescence parameters can be mapped with micrometer resolution so that individual chloroplasts or even grana-stroma thylakoid segments can be investigated.
Key Features:
- Combination of kinetic Chl/GFP-fluorescence imaging and standard wide-field fluorescence microscopy (in certain versions).
- Motorized 6-position filter wheel (in certain versions).
- Multiple fluorophores imaging (in certain versions).
- 10 µs to 20 ms exposure time per frame
- 512 x 512 (or 640 x 480, or 1392 x 1040) pixels spatial resolution.
- 12bit dynamic range.
- 70 % peak quantum yield with about 4 electrons readout noise.
- The instrument combines an attractive price with the advantage of portability.

All Device Versions Can Be Supplied With:
A. Standard Camera:
- 512 x 512 pixels.
- A/D: 12 bit (4096 grey levels).
- 8.2 µm x 8.4 µm pixel size.
- 50 images per second.
- Advantageous for rapid processes measurements.
B. Advanced Camera:
- 640 x 480 pixels and 1392 x 1040 pixels, respectively.
- A/D: 12 bit (4096 grey levels).
- 6.45 µm x 6.45 µm pixel size.
- 30 and 15 images per second, respectively.
- Great for slow processes measurements and for applications where the higher spatial resolution is of high importance.

QA-Reoxidation Option
High-end option allowing determination of QA-reoxidation kinetics. QA-reoxidation is recorded in a pump-and-probe manner, i.e. using repetitive flashes and recording with variable delay after each flash.
